上一页 1 2 3 4 5 6 ··· 8 下一页
摘要: public: Java语言中访问限制最宽的修饰符,一般称之为“公共的”。被其修饰的类、属性以及方法不 仅可以跨类访问,而且允许跨包(package)访问。 private: Java语言中对访问权限限制的最窄的修饰符,一般称之为“私有的”。被其修饰的类、属性以 及方法只能被该类的对象访问,其子类不 阅读全文
posted @ 2020-06-11 16:34 北城cheng 阅读(662) 评论(0) 推荐(0) 编辑
摘要: String 是一个不可变的,由 final 修饰的类。 不可变类是指其实例不能被修改的类。每个实例中包含的所有信息都必须在创建该实例的时候就提供,并且在对象的整个生命周期内固定不变。为了使类不可变,要遵循下面五条规则: 1. 不要提供任何会修改对象状态的方法。 2. 保证类不会被扩展。 一般的做法 阅读全文
posted @ 2020-06-06 09:23 北城cheng 阅读(1156) 评论(0) 推荐(0) 编辑
摘要: (1)服务发现-- Netflix Eureka 由两个组件组成:Eureka服务端和Eureka客户端 Eureka服务端用作服务注册中心,支持集群部署 工作原理: 在应用启动时,Eureka客户端向服务端注册自己的服务信息,同时将服务端的服务信息缓存到本地。客户端会和服务端进行周期性的进行心跳交 阅读全文
posted @ 2020-06-02 21:30 北城cheng 阅读(1231) 评论(0) 推荐(0) 编辑
摘要: 在HTTP/1.0中默认使用短连接。也就是说,客户端和服务器每进行一次HTTP操作,就建立一次连接,任务结束就中断连接。当客户端浏览器访问的某个HTML或其他类型的Web页中包含有其他的Web资源(如JavaScript文件、图像文件、CSS文件等),每遇到这样一个Web资源,浏览器就会重新建立一个 阅读全文
posted @ 2020-05-29 22:05 北城cheng 阅读(3585) 评论(0) 推荐(0) 编辑
摘要: 连接池中到底应该放置多少连接,才能使系统的性能最佳?系统可采取设置最小连接数(minConn)和最大连接数(maxConn)来控制连接池中的连接。最小连接数是系统启动时连接池所创建的连接数。如果创建过多,则系统启动就慢,但创建后系统的响应速度会很快;如果创建过少,则系统启动的很快,响应起来却慢。这样 阅读全文
posted @ 2020-05-28 22:17 北城cheng 阅读(195) 评论(0) 推荐(0) 编辑
摘要: 面向对象是一种万物皆对象的思想,主要有三个特性 1)继承:继承是从已有类继承信息创建新类的过程。提供继承信息的类被称为父类(超类、基类);得到继承信息的类被称为子类(派生类)。继承让变化中的软件系统有了一定的延续性,同时继承也是封装程序中可变因素的重要手段。任何用父类的地方都应该能被子类代替,子类应 阅读全文
posted @ 2020-05-25 11:04 北城cheng 阅读(362) 评论(0) 推荐(0) 编辑
摘要: 1.ActiveMQ重试机制是什么? 消费者收到消息,之后出现异常了,没有告诉broker确认收到该消息,broker会尝试再将该消息发送给消费者。尝试n次,如果消费者还是没有确认收到该消息,那么该消息将被放到死信队列中,之后broker不会再将该消息发送给消费者。 2.具体哪些情况会引发消息重发? 阅读全文
posted @ 2020-05-21 22:19 北城cheng 阅读(1553) 评论(0) 推荐(0) 编辑
摘要: 主要有jdbc kahadb leveldb+zookeeper几种持久化方式 1.jdbc:jdbc比如借助mysql,需要在actviemq.xml配置(<PersistenceAdapter>),<persistenceAdapter> <jdbcPersistenceAdapter data 阅读全文
posted @ 2020-05-18 16:50 北城cheng 阅读(582) 评论(0) 推荐(0) 编辑
摘要: 1.zookeeper中任意节点收到写请求,如果是follower节点,则会把写请求转发给leader,如果是leader节点就直接进行下一步。 2.leader生成一个新的事务并为这个事务生成一个唯一的ZXID 3.leader将这个事务发送给所有的follows节点 4.follower节点将收 阅读全文
posted @ 2020-05-17 22:31 北城cheng 阅读(2310) 评论(1) 推荐(1) 编辑
摘要: G1 同样存在着年代的概念,但其内部是类似棋盘状的一个个 region 组成。 region 的大小是一致的,数值是在 1M 到 32M 字节之间的一个 2 的幂值数,JVM 会尽量划分 2048 个左右、同等大小的 region。当然这个数字既可以手动调整,G1 也会根据堆大小自动进行调整。在 G 阅读全文
posted @ 2020-05-14 22:21 北城cheng 阅读(226) 评论(0) 推荐(0) 编辑
上一页 1 2 3 4 5 6 ··· 8 下一页